The Wrong Factory Got Fined Into Oblivion — and an Entire Species Got Its Life Back
Somewhere in a regional EPA field office in the early 1990s, a regulator typed the wrong name into a form. It was probably a Tuesday. There was probably bad coffee involved. The error was small — a single transposed word in a corporate name — and it sent a six-figure environmental penalty to a chemical processing facility that had nothing to do with the violation being cited.
That mistake quietly saved a species from extinction.
This is not a story about good intentions. Nobody involved was trying to protect wildlife. This is a story about how catastrophically wrong bureaucratic processes can accidentally produce the right outcome, and how messy it gets when someone eventually figures that out.
Two Companies, One Catastrophic Mix-Up
The two companies at the center of this story operated in the same general industrial corridor in the southeastern United States. Their names were different enough that, under normal circumstances, no one would confuse them. But in the early 1990s, both companies had recently restructured, and their updated registered business names were nearly identical — differing by a single word that appeared in the middle of a long corporate title.
The EPA's regional enforcement division had been investigating a pattern of illegal chemical discharge into a river system. The guilty party — let's call them Company A — had been systematically releasing industrial runoff containing heavy metals and chlorinated compounds at levels well above permitted limits. The investigation had taken two years. The fine, when it finally came, was substantial: somewhere in the neighborhood of $310,000, plus mandatory remediation requirements.
The paperwork went to Company B.
Company B manufactured specialty coatings for industrial equipment. They were not saints — no chemical company operating in that era was — but they were not the source of the documented discharge. They were also significantly smaller than Company A, operating on thin margins, and had no legal department capable of mounting a serious regulatory challenge.
Faced with a fine they couldn't pay and a remediation order they couldn't comply with — because the contamination wasn't theirs and they had no idea where it actually was — Company B did the only thing they could afford to do. They shut down.
The River Gets Quiet
For the next several years, very little happened publicly. Company A continued operating, apparently unaware that their penalty had been misdelivered. The EPA's regional office marked the case as resolved. Company B's facility sat empty.
What nobody was tracking at the time was what was happening about forty miles downstream, in a stretch of wetland habitat that a small team of university biologists had been quietly monitoring since the late 1980s.
The species in question was a freshwater mussel — not glamorous, not the kind of creature that ends up on fundraising posters — that had been listed as critically endangered. Its population had been declining steadily for a decade, and the leading hypothesis was habitat degradation, though the specific mechanism hadn't been pinned down.
Starting around 1993, something changed. The population stopped declining. By 1995, it was growing. By 1997, the biologists were cautiously using words like "recovery trajectory" in their field notes.
They didn't know why.
Connecting the Dots
The connection between Company B's closure and the mussel's recovery wasn't made until 1999, when a graduate student working on her dissertation began mapping industrial discharge points against population data for freshwater invertebrates in the region. She wasn't looking for this story. She was looking for something else entirely and tripped over it.
When she traced the discharge patterns backward, the timeline lined up almost exactly. Company B's specialty coating process had involved a specific chemical compound that, it turned out, was acutely toxic to freshwater mussels at concentrations that were legal under the existing permit structure — legal because the permits predated the research establishing the compound's effects on invertebrates. The company hadn't been violating any rules. They'd just been quietly poisoning a species that nobody had thought to protect them from yet.
When the facility went dark, the compound stopped entering the watershed. The mussels came back.
The graduate student's dissertation was eventually published. It attracted attention from wildlife biologists, then from environmental law scholars, and eventually from journalists. That's when the EPA's original paperwork error came to light.
The Legal Nightmare Nobody Asked For
Once it became clear that Company B had been fined for Company A's violations, the legal situation became, in the words of one environmental law professor who reviewed the case, "genuinely unprecedented and also kind of a disaster."
Company B — or rather, its former owners — had a legitimate grievance. They'd been put out of business by a regulatory error. But the remediation order they'd been unable to comply with had technically never been resolved, meaning the EPA was in the awkward position of having an open enforcement action against a company that no longer existed, for pollution it hadn't caused.
Company A, meanwhile, had spent six years operating without consequence for violations that had been documented, fined, and then accidentally forgiven through administrative confusion. When the correct fine was finally issued in 2001, Company A contested it aggressively, arguing in part that the delay constituted a form of regulatory abandonment. That argument did not succeed, but it added another two years to the proceedings.
The former owners of Company B received a formal acknowledgment of the error and a partial reimbursement of legal costs they'd incurred during the original enforcement process — which, given that they'd largely just given up rather than fought, amounted to a modest sum that didn't come close to covering what the business had been worth.
The Species That Bureaucracy Saved
The mussel population has continued to recover. The wetland stretch that serves as its primary habitat has since been designated as a protected area, partly on the strength of the recovery data that began accumulating after 1993.
No one planned any of this. No regulator made a visionary decision. No company made a sacrifice. A clerk typed the wrong name, a small business couldn't afford a lawyer, and a freshwater mussel got a second chance at existence.
